The Science Behind Ph Levels
In chemistry, pH measures how acidic or basic a solution is. The scale ranges from 0 to 14, with 7 being neutral. Lower numbers indicate acidity, while higher numbers indicate alkalinity. Most cleaning solutions have specific pH levels that determine their effectiveness in breaking down different types of stains.
Understanding Different Types of Stains
Different stains have various chemical compositions, which means they respond differently to cleaning agents. For example, coffee and wine stains are usually acidic, so they require alkaline cleaners for effective carpet stain removal. On the other hand, oil-based stains might need a more acidic cleaner to break them down efficiently.
The Importance of Correct Ph Balance
Using the correct pH-balanced cleaning agent is important for successful carpet stain removal. An incorrect pH level can result in ineffective cleaning or even damage to the carpet fibers. For instance, using an overly acidic cleaner on a delicate fabric could lead to discoloration or fiber breakdown.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
One common mistake is using a single cleaning product for all stains without considering pH balance. Another error is rinsing inadequately after applying a cleaner, which may leave residue. Both mistakes can lead to poor results and potential damage.
Best Practices for Effective Stain Removal
To ensure optimal cleaning, always test a new product on a small area first. Follow instructions carefully and rinse thoroughly to avoid leaving any residue. Regularly vacuuming carpets also helps maintain them by preventing dirt accumulation that can turn into stubborn stains over time.
